SWOT Analysis

Strengths

3 points
  • The company demonstrated robust quarterly performance with sales growing by 60.90% and net profit by 38.10% in the latest quarter, indicating strong operational momentum and demand for its products.
  • DCX Systems maintains a very healthy balance sheet with a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.00, suggesting strong financial stability and low reliance on external borrowings, which is positive for long-term sustainability.

Weaknesses

5 points
  • The company exhibits low profitability with a Return on Equity (ROE) of 3.11% and Return on Capital Employed (ROCE) of 5.10%, significantly trailing industry peers and suggesting inefficient capital utilization.
  • With a P/E ratio of 62.40, DCX Systems appears highly valued, especially when compared to its low profitability metrics and some peers like HAL (37.79) and BEL (54.11) with better returns.

Opportunities

3 points
  • Operating in the "Aerospace & Defense" industry, the company stands to benefit from increasing government spending, modernization initiatives, and 'Make in India' push, driving future demand.
  • Given its core capabilities, DCX Systems has an opportunity to diversify its product offerings or expand into new geographical markets, leveraging its existing expertise to capture a larger market share.

Threats

4 points
  • The "Aerospace & Defense" sector features large, established players like HAL and BEL with superior ROCE (33.88% and 38.88%), posing significant competitive pressure and market share challenges for DCX Systems.
  • The defense sector is highly regulated; changes in government procurement policies, import/export regulations, or budget allocations could significantly impact DCX Systems' order book and operational stability.

About

DCXINDIA

DCX Systems Ltd

DCX Systems Limited is a prominent player in the electronic manufacturing services (EMS) sector, specializing in the design, manufacture, and sale of electronic integration systems and cable and wire harnessing. Their operations span both domestic (India) and international markets, catering to a diverse range of industries.

A core component of DCX Systems' business is the production and supply of various cabling and harnessing solutions. This includes a comprehensive portfolio of products such as cable and harness assemblies, fine wire cables, flex flat cables, backplanes, conduit assemblies, EMI shield cable harnesses, and wired enclosures. They also offer specialized connectors tailored to specific customer requirements.

Beyond cabling, DCX Systems provides a broad spectrum of electronic manufacturing services. These encompass printed circuit board (PCB) assembly, electro-mechanical assemblies, design for manufacturability (DFM) analysis, and a variety of specialized processes including conformal coating. Their capabilities further extend to the programming of integrated circuits (ICs) and field-programmable gate arrays (FPGAs), comprehensive testing procedures (in-circuit, functional, burn-in, environmental stress screening, and vibration testing), and repair/upgrade services.

The company's customer base significantly involves the aerospace, defense, and industrial automation sectors. This includes supplying components and services for land and naval defense systems, satellites, and civil aviation. Their expertise also extends to subsystem assembly, system integration, testing, and kitting services, demonstrating a vertically integrated approach to fulfilling customer needs.

In summary, DCX Systems Limited's business model is characterized by its comprehensive offering of electronic integration systems, cable and harness solutions, and extensive EMS capabilities. Their focus on high-quality, specialized services and a strong presence in demanding sectors like aerospace and defense establishes them as a key player in the Indian and global electronics manufacturing landscape.
